Calanggaman Island
Calanggaman Island is a small islet south of Malapascua. We typically do two dives here.
The first dive starts on an awesome wall covered with gorgonians and black coral and ends on a sandy slope where you can see eagle rays and blue spotted sting rays.
The second dive is on an extensive hard coral reef where you can see nudibranchs, frogfish and all kind of reef fishes.
Depth: 15 – 50+ meters on the wall, 12 to 20 meters on the reef
Current: none to slight
Visibility: 20 – 30+ meters
Recommended level of training: Open water diver
Distance: 1,5 hours from Malapascua
